Kinds Of Cataract Surgery
Types of cataract surgical treatment can vary relying on the extent of the problem and also individual needs. The most typical type is phacoemulsification, which uses ultrasound energy to break up the over cast lens and remove it with a small laceration.
Extracapsular cataract removal is an additional choice, entailing a larger incision to get rid of the gloomy lens unscathed.
In many cases, laser-assisted cataract surgical procedure might be suggested. This treatment uses a laser to make exact lacerations and soften the lens for removal.
Your cosmetic surgeon will go over the most effective alternative for you based on your particular circumstance and also choices.
